Eating Your Vegetables the RIGHT Way!

So whether you're on the Candida diet or not, it's often hard to eat enough vegetables in a day. People are much better about getting their allotment of fruit per day, but for people on the Candida diet, fruit cannot be eaten in large quantities. The Candida diet promotes centering your diet around healthy fresh vegetables that can be eaten raw or cooked. Personally, I don't like too many vegetables raw, so I find myself cooking vegetables a LOT. This can get annoying, eating the same foods over and over, so I like to add a little variety to my diet.

A good way to eat fresh vegetables, that taste AMAZING, is to add almond meal, or almond flour. I like to take Zucchini and Yellow Squash and cut them into slices, then dip them in egg and coat them with the almond. Put them in a pan with a little butter and fry them up! If you want to make a bunch, get out a cookie sheet and place them on the cookie sheet after they're done frying, and turn the oven on low to keep them warm while you make more. This is by far my favorite vegetable recipe, and I hope you enjoy it as well!
